Loading...
1

Used 2016 BMW Z4 Convertible for Sale in Naperville, IL

2016 BMW Z4 sDrive35i
2016 BMW Z4 sDrive35i
2016 BMW Z4 sDrive35i
Used·50,801 mi

$27,890